# Important Note:
I created the `combined` metric (55% F1 score + 45% exact match score) and load the state with the best result at the end. Here is the setting in the `TrainingArguments`:
```
load_best_model_at_end=True,
metric_for_best_model='combined',
greater_is_better=True,
```
# DSPFirst-Finetuning-5
This model is a fine-tuned version of [ahotrod/electra_large_discriminator_squad2_512](https://huggingface.co/ahotrod/electra_large_discriminator_squad2_512) on a generated Questions and Answers dataset from the DSPFirst textbook based on the SQuAD 2.0 format.<br />
It achieves the following results on the evaluation set:
- Loss: 0.8529
- Exact: 67.0964
- F1: 74.4842
- Combined: 71.1597

## Intended uses & limitations
This model is fine-tuned to answer questions from the DSPFirst textbook. I'm not really sure what I am doing so you should review before using it.<br />
Also, you should improve the Dataset either by using a **better generated questions and answers model** (currently using https://github.com/patil-suraj/question_generation) or perform **data augmentation** to increase dataset size.
## Training and evaluation data
- `batch_size` of 6 results in 14.03 GB VRAM
- Utilizes `gradient_accumulation_steps` to get total batch size to 516 (total batch size should be at least 256)
- 4.52 GB RAM
- 30% of the total questions is dedicated for evaluating.
## Training procedure
- The model was trained from [Google Colab](https://colab.research.google.com/drive/1dJXNstk2NSenwzdtl9xA8AqjP4LL-Ks_?usp=sharing)
- Utilizes Tesla P100 16GB, took 6.3 hours to train
- `load_best_model_at_end` is enabled in TrainingArguments
### Training hyperparameters
The following hyperparameters were used during training:
- learning_rate: 2e-05
- train_batch_size: 6
- eval_batch_size: 6
- seed: 42
- gradient_accumulation_steps: 86
- total_train_batch_size: 516
- optimizer: Adam with betas=(0.9,0.999) and epsilon=1e-08
- lr_scheduler_type: linear
- num_epochs: 7
### Model hyperparameters
- hidden_dropout_prob: 0.36
- attention_probs_dropout_prob = 0.36
